Eichen-Zwergblattroller vs Guildford Piercer
Pammene albuginana compared with Pammene agnotana
Key Differences
- Eichen-Zwergblattroller is Least Concern while Guildford Piercer is Near Threatened.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Eichen-Zwergblattroller | Guildford Piercer |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Tier) | Animalia (Tier) |
| Phylum same | Arthropoda (Gliederfüßer) | Arthropoda (Gliederfüßer) |
| Class same | Insecta (Insekten) | Insecta (Insekten) |
| Order same | Lepidoptera (Schmetterlinge) | Lepidoptera (Schmetterlinge) |
| Family same | Tortricidae | Tortricidae |
| Genus same | Pammene | Pammene |
| Species | Pammene albuginana | Pammene agnotana |
Evolutionary Relationship
Eichen-Zwergblattroller and Guildford Piercer share a common ancestor at the Genus level: Pammene.
